Security Issues
- Recursive delete permission bypass via empty directory omission
The recursive delete authorization scan inFilesystemMiddleware._delete_denied_path()(and its async counterpart_adelete_denied_path()) enumerates subtree contents exclusively throughbackend.glob("**/*", path=target).matches. TheFilesystemBackend.glob()implementation explicitly skips non-file entries (if not is_file: continue), meaning empty directories are never returned._scan_delete_for_denied_path()then derives intermediate directories only from the file paths returned — so any empty directory in the subtree, including one that is the direct target of adeny writepermission rule, is never checked. An attacker-controlled LLM agent can issuedelete("/allowed/parent"), the pre-check passes (glob returns no files to check), andshutil.rmtree()then silently removes every empty denied directory under/allowed/parent.

Security Issues
- Uncontrolled Resource Consumption
The new recursiveStoreBackend.delete()path (and its async twinadelete()) calls_search_store_paginated()/_asearch_store_paginated(), which accumulates every page of the entire namespace into an unbounded in-memory list before filtering by the requested prefix. These helpers have no maximum item/byte cap and no timeout guard. Because thedeletetool is exposed as a LangGraph tool throughFilesystemMiddleware— callable by any agent that receives user input — an attacker (or a prompt-injected agent) can triggerdelete("/")or a similarly broad path and force the server to load the entire namespace into memory before attempting the deletions. The async variant is equally affected. All other methods that call_search_store_paginated()(e.g.grep,glob) share the same unbounded-scan pattern, butdeleteadditionally issues a single massivebatch()call proportional to the number of keys found.
Recommendation
- Avoid full namespace scans for delete. Use key-prefix queries if the store backend supports them, or stream pages with strict maximum item/byte limits and delete in bounded batches.
- Reject overly broad recursive deletes (e.g.
/) at the schema or validation layer unless explicitly approved by a permission rule. - Add a hard cap (e.g. 10 000 items) inside
_search_store_paginated()/_asearch_store_paginated()so that all callers are protected.

The recursive delete path loads the entire namespace before filtering keys for the requested prefix:
items = self._search_store_paginated(store, namespace)
to_delete = expand_delete_keys((str(item.key) for item in items), file_path)_search_store_paginated() (store.py:376) accumulates every page into all_items: list[Item] with no maximum item or byte cap. For a namespace with N items this runs ceil(N/100) round-trips to the store and allocates O(N) heap objects before a single key is deleted. The subsequent store.batch([PutOp(..., None) for key in to_delete]) then issues all N deletions in one unbounded request with no chunking or back-pressure.
The delete tool is exposed as a LangGraph StructuredTool callable by any agent that processes user messages. validate_path() accepts / as a valid path (it only blocks traversal sequences), so an attacker — or a prompt-injected agent — can call delete("/") to trigger a full-namespace scan and wipe. No rate-limiting, no max-items guard, and no timeout exist at any layer in the delete path. The async variant (adelete(), store.py:742) is identically affected.
Remediation:
- Add a hard cap (e.g.
MAX_SCAN_ITEMS = 10_000) inside_search_store_paginated()and_asearch_store_paginated()that raises an exception if the accumulator exceeds the limit — this protects all callers, not just delete. - For delete specifically, use a prefix-aware store query (pass a
filter/querytostore.search()) so only matching keys are fetched rather than the entire namespace. - Chunk
to_deleteinto bounded batches (e.g. ≤ 500 keys perstore.batch()call) with optional yield points for async. - Reject delete paths of
/or other root-level broad paths at the schema orvalidate_path()layer unless an explicit permission rule approves them.

Combines the v0.7-only delete support work originally merged through: - langchain-ai#3659 - langchain-ai#3691 - langchain-ai#3765 - langchain-ai#3851 Adds a `delete` filesystem tool backed by the backend protocol and supported by state, store, filesystem, sandbox, context-hub, and composite backends. The tool deletes files or directories recursively, and prefix-style backends remove the exact key plus nested descendants. Filesystem permissions treat `delete` as a write operation. Because recursive deletes can affect descendants, deny and interrupt checks use bulk path overlap instead of exact-path matching. BREAKING CHANGE: Agents now see a destructive `delete` filesystem tool when the backend supports it. Existing agents may choose to remove files or directories recursively, and existing filesystem permission rules that allow writes can now authorize deletion unless a narrower deny or interrupt rule blocks the target subtree.

The filesystem delete tool only removed single files and rejected directories, so clearing a directory (e.g. a subagent's working dir) meant one tool call per file and left the empty directories behind. This makes delete remove directories recursively, renames the tool from
delete_filetodelete, and makes the permission layer treat a recursive delete as a single all-or-nothing operation over the whole subtree.What changed:
FilesystemBackend.deletenow removes directories recursively (shutil.rmtree). Symlinks are removed as links, never followed into their target.delete_filetodelete(the arg is stillfile_path).deletemaps to thewriteoperation. For a directory target, the tool expands the subtree and checkswriteon the target and every descendant; if any path is denied, the entire delete is refused and nothing is removed (all-or-nothing).deleteis now registered forinterrupt-mode permissions (bulk scope), so an interrupt rule on any path inside the target fires before the delete runs. It was previously absent, so interrupt rules never applied to deletes.Why all-or-nothing: a recursive delete of a directory is one intent. If part of it is protected, refusing cleanly is safer and more predictable than leaving a half-deleted tree, and the agent can still delete the allowed paths explicitly.
